[0035]FIG. 1 illustrates a perspective view of an embodiment of a slip conduit connector 20 according to the present invention. The slip conduit connector has a hollow cylindrical member 22 having a first end 24 and a second end 26. The hollow cylindrical member is dimensioned for receipt of an electrical conduit 28 as seen in FIGS. 9 and 10. This embodiment is preferably fabricated from zinc plated steel.
[0036]As seen in FIG. 1, the hollow cylindrical member has at least one threaded bore 30, the threads dimensioned for receipt of a corresponding fastener 32 which when threaded into the bore can make electrical and mechanical contact with the electrical conduit 28 as seen in FIG. 10.
[0037]FIG. 1 shows that this embodiment of the present invention can preferably have two threaded bores near first end 24.
